Default Wire voltmeter straight up?

I just got in the mail my cheepie (10 bucks) voltmeter , was gona wire it to key switch but would like to just wire it straight up so voltage reading is there all the time , surly that little thing (way , Way SMALLER than it looked in the pic) wouldn't be any load on the batteries would it ?

88 resistor cart by the way...
